Pregnancy Hair :(

Hello Ladies,

 I dont know about anyone else but my hair has a mind of its own now. Everyday is a  bad hair day. My hair is thicker which is great! But.... it is also dry and unmanageable. Does anyone have a tips or remdies for dry unruly pregnancy hair????

  • My hair dresser told me a long time ago to get a hair mask.  It is like a super deep conditioner.  Put it on and leave it over night.  Some dry so you could just sleep on a towel or put your hair up in a shower cap.  Hair masks can be expensive so she also said that you can do it with regular conditioner too. Works amazingly!!!
